§ 16-6a-114 — Penalty for signing false documents.

Utah·Title 16 Corporations·Ch. 16-6a Utah Revised Nonprofit Corporation Act·Part 16-6a-1 General Provisions
(1)It is unlawful for a person to sign a document:
(1)(a) knowing it to be false in any material respect; and
(1)(b) with intent that the document be delivered to the division for filing.
(2)An offense under this section is a class A misdemeanor punishable by a fine not to exceed the fine specified in Section 76-3-301.

Legislative History

Enacted by Chapter 300, 2000 General Session
